Archie William Kittinger

May 1, 1930 — January 16, 2013

Archie William Kittinger, age 82, passed away suddenly on Wednesday, January 16, 2013 at his residence. He was born on May 1, 1930 in Mclean County to the late William Hansford and Edna Galloway Kittinger.

By a stroke of luck he met the love of his life on a blind date in 1949 and 6 months later married Betty Decker in 1950 prior to his enlistment in the Army in 1952; where he served during the Korean conflict. Mr. Kittinger graduated from Sacramento High School and later in life attended Kentucky Wesleyan College and Brescia College. Archie began working at Owensboro Grain in 1954 and remained there for 35 years retiring as secretary and treasurer. After his retirement, he pursued positions at Hampton Inn, Stacy Chrysler and the Owensboro YMCA.

He and his wife have been members of Owensboro Christian Church for over forty years; where he was involved in the choir, Bible Study Class and Ambassadors. Being a fan of Kentucky Wesleyan College it stood to reason that he belonged to the All American Club where he served as President. With the love of the outdoors he and his wife were members of the Friendship Camping Club where they enjoyed camping with many friends. Above all, Archie's favorite hobby was spending time with his family, especially with his grandchildren and great-grandchildren.
